Transaction 7f2764e43b493fcdb33c4e4b802a528d09f97a407678d82cfbc9e62b6d45329f

40 Input
2 Outputs
  • 7f2764e43b493fcdb33c4e4b802a528d09f97a407678d82cfbc9e62b6d45329f:0
  • value  983811
    address  3F2prCiDHNwkdHZ83bwNr6ePqkvueQu5Y9
  • 7f2764e43b493fcdb33c4e4b802a528d09f97a407678d82cfbc9e62b6d45329f:1
  • value  316509672
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s